I've added carbon fiber hood vent arrows. This completes the exterior carbon fiber trim that I have planned for my car. My original goal was to replace all of the bright silver trim. I didn't think the bright silver was a good match for my paint color. After seeing how the CF looked I went well beyond my original plans. I've done the front lip, bumper vents, fender vents, hood vents, side mirrors, rear spoiler and rear diffusor.

A big thanks to Ivan at DCT Motorsports. Top quality parts at a reasonable price. I've been fortunate that I can drive to his shop to speak with him in person. He's extremely knowledgeable on the process of coating carbon fiber over OEM parts. Quality is his first priority. I was told it is very difficult to wrap CF over the hood vent arrows due to the sharpness of the angle on top. All 6 are perfect.
